Understanding your partner's love language can dramatically enhance your relationship. It involves recognizing how they best perceive love. Some common love languages encompass copyright of affirmation, acts of service, receiving gifts, quality time, and physical touch. By learning their primary language, you can express your affection in a way that truly resonates with them.
- copyright of affirmation can be as simple as saying "I love you" or "You look fantastic today."
- Acts of service demonstrate your thoughtfulness through helpful actions, like doing the dishes or running errands.
- Thoughtful items don't have to be extravagant; they should be significant and show you were thinking of them.
- Quality time involves giving your full attention with your partner, participating in activities together.
- Physical touch can be as simple as holding hands or giving a hug; it conveys warmth and connection.

Secrets for a Happy and Healthy Couple
A truly wonderful relationship thrives on clear and genuine communication. Don't just talk, understand one another's thoughts. Make room for daily check-ins to express your concerns and challenges. Remember, even a simple "I love you" can make a world.
- Develop active listening skills by paying full attention when your partner is speaking.
- Use "I" statements to express your feelings without blaming or attacking.
- Stay patient and understanding, remembering that every person expresses themselves differently.
